In the Shadow of His Wings.

Psalm 57:1
1 Have mercy on me, O God, have mercy on me,
for in you my soul takes refuge.
I will take refuge in the shadow of your wings
until the disaster has passed.


It's human instinct to take cover when there are dark clouds approaching, when it's raining, or when there's lightning in the area. There are some dare devils who brave the storm, but it's not easy to do. If we have common sense, we know that we shouldn't mess with Mother Nature.

The same fundamental decisions are at stake when there are the much anticipated storms within our soul. We are tricked into thinking that we have to go face-to-face with our battles alone or claim that we're not really in a storm. However, the best choice of all is to take shelter from the impending danger. We can satisfy and comfort ourselves by finding rest in God.

If you step out into the storms of life, you're not only physically in danger, but you're emotionally in danger. Your soul is at risk. As God's people, we need to surrender to him and know that he has no limits and he has all the capabilities you could imagine. We don't need to fight the fight. All you have to do is hunker down, love God, and pray from a fearful perspective.

Just remember that you are safe in the arms of Christ. Once you have hope that the Lord can give you strength, the stir in your soul will settle.
